In the MLS match held on 2 April 2023, the Chicago Fire went head to head with DC United. Despite energetic performances from both sides, the game ended in a 0-0 stalemate, highlighting the impressive defensive strategies and performances.
One of the main factors that stood out in the game was the amount of corner kicks won by both teams. Astonishingly, Chicago Fire acquired a high number of corner kicks–a total of 19, the largest figure in the match. This clearly demonstrates their significant territorial advantage over DC United. Despite these numerous opportunities, they were unable to capitalise and convert them into goals. This lack of finishing touch in the final third remains a significant concern for Chicago Fire.
On the contrary, DC United only managed to secure 5 corner kicks throughout the match. However, they too were unable to utilise these set-piece opportunities to secure a goal. Both teams' failure to convert corner kicks into goals seems to underline the robust defensive frames put in place and reinforced throughout the match.
The discipline of both teams was quite contrasting during this match. DC United saw themselves dealt 4 yellow cards — two in the first half and two in the second half. This not only reflects DC United’s aggressive style of play, but it could also potentially have an adverse psychological impact on the team hindering their performance.
On the other hand, the Chicago Fire team maintained an exceptional disciplinary record, with no yellow or red cards throughout the match. This not only demonstrates their tactical proficiency but also their disciplined approach to the game.
Regarding the offside traps, Chicago Fire was judged offside twice while DC United was only trapped once. The limited number of offsides for both sides reflects their cautious approach in attack rather than aggressive forward moves.
In conclusion, the 0-0 scoreline was a testament to the strong defensive tactics put in place and maintained by both teams. Chicago Fire were able to exhibit territorial dominance, albeit failing to convert these opportunities. Meanwhile, DC United's disciplinary record stood out as a potentially troubling aspect of their approach to the game which they will need to reflect on moving forward. Despite no goals being netted, there was no lack of competition or dedication on either side.
